  6. From The Daily Sentinel Standard
    "GEORGE G. Ostrander - George 0. Ostrander, 59, of Rt. 2, Ionia, diedMonday at 2:20 A.M. in the University of Michigan hospital, Ann Arbor,where he had been a patient for several weeks. He had submitted. to amajor operation December 30. His death occurred just three weeks afterthat of his wife. who died December 20 at the Ionia County Memorialhospital. Mr. Ostrander: was born September 4, 1884, In Ionia countywhere he had been a life-long resident. For many years the couple hadresided on their farm in Ionia township but for nearly three years theyhad lived on the Minty farm. He is survived by a daughter, Mrs. Fred D.Smith. of Flint; also LaVern A. DeForest, S2/C, with the U. S. navalSeabeas In the south Pacific area: a brother S. S. 0strander of Ionia:two sisters, Mrs Claude Furnish of Morrice and Mrs Bert Morgan of Ionia.A daughter, Frances, was fatally injured in an automobile accidentDecember 26, 1940. The body was taken to the Stone funeral home andfuneral arrangements will be announced later."
